М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
20Bella04
20Bella04
25.04.2023 19:56 •  Информатика

Напишите программу в паскаль, которая получает день и номер месяца, а выводит количество дней, оставшихся до нового года. считайте, что год невисокосный (365 дней). учтите, что слово "дней" может иметь также формы "день" и "дня". пример: введите день и месяц: 25 12 осталось 7 дней до нового года. пример: введите день и месяц: 1 1 осталось 364 дня до нового года. пример: введите день и месяц: 31 2 неверная дата.

👇
Ответ:
fgydsgfgysa
fgydsgfgysa
25.04.2023
//PascalABC
Uses System;
var day, month: integer;
begin
  Read(day, month);    var d := new DateTime(DateTime.Now.Year, month, day);    var new_year := new DateTime(d.Year+1, 1, 1);    Writeln((new_year - d).TotalDays);  end.
4,4(71 оценок)
Открыть все ответы
Ответ:
VikaKharitoniv
VikaKharitoniv
25.04.2023
В первом примере кода будет выведено число 31, далее символ "-" и число 12, затем снова символ "-" и число 2019. Результат будет выглядеть так: 31-12-2019.

Во втором примере кода будет выведено слово Mercury, затем символ "*", затем слово Venus. После этого будет напечатан символ "!", и начнется новая строка. Затем будет выведено слово Mars, после него символ "**", затем слово Jupiter. В конце будет напечатан символ "?". Результат будет выглядеть так:
Mercury*Venus!
Mars**Jupiter?

В третьем примере кода будет распечатано 6 строк. Первая строка будет содержать символ "a", затем символ "*", затем символ "b", затем символ "*", затем символ "c". После этого будет напечатан символ "*", затем символ "d", затем символ "*", затем символ "e", затем символ "*", затем символ "f". В конце строки будет напечатан символ "*", но он не будет отображен на экране из-за параметра end='', который указывает, что необходимо подавить вывод символа перевода строки. Затем будет напечатан символ "+", затем символ "g", затем символ "+", затем символ "h", затем символ "+", затем символ "i". В конце строки будет напечатан символ "%", затем символ "-", который обозначает перевод на новую строку. Затем будет выведено слово "j", затем символ "-", затем слово "k", затем символ "-", затем слово "l". В конце строки будет напечатан символ "-", затем символ "/", затем символ "m", затем символ "/", затем символ "n", затем символ "/", затем символ "o". В конце строки будет напечатан символ "/", затем символ "!", затем символ "p", затем символ "1", затем символ "q", затем символ "1", затем символ "r". В конце строки будет напечатан символ "1", затем символ "&", затем символ "s", затем символ "&", затем символ "t", затем символ "&", затем символ "u". В конце строки будет напечатан символ "&", затем символ перевода строки "\n", затем символ "%", затем символ "v", затем символ "%", затем символ "w", затем символ "%", затем символ "x". В конце строки будет напечатан символ "%", затем символ "/", затем символ "y", затем символ "/", затем символ "z". В конце строки будет напечатан символ "/" и символ "!", но они не будут отображены на экране из-за параметра end=''. Результат будет выглядеть так:
a*b*c*d*e*f+g+h+i
j-k-l/m/n/o!p1q1r&s&t&u
v%w%x/y/z
4,6(75 оценок)
Ответ:
ЭлькаЭля
ЭлькаЭля
25.04.2023
Добрый день! Рад поведать тебе о количестве информации и как его можно использовать для определения количества возможных событий.

Давай начнем с первого вопроса. У нас есть информация о количестве информации, полученной после реализации одного возможного события – 15 бит. Что такое "бит"? "Бит" является единицей измерения количества информации и может быть представлен как единица или ноль. Другими словами, у нас есть 15 выборов, каждый из которых может быть либо единицей, либо нулем.

Теперь давай посмотрим на количество возможных событий. Мы хотим найти количество возможных событий, которые могут произойти до получения 15 бит информации. Если каждый выбор может быть единицей или нулем, то у нас есть 2 варианта для первого выбора, 2 варианта для второго выбора, 2 варианта для третьего выбора и так далее. В результате мы можем найти общее количество возможных событий, умножив количество вариантов на каждом шаге: 2 * 2 * 2 * ... * 2 = 2^15.

Таким образом, количество возможных событий первоначально равно 2^15, что равно 32768.

Теперь перейдем ко второму вопросу. Здесь нам говорится о получении 10 битов информации при угадывании целого числа в диапазоне от 1 до N. Что это значит? Это означает, что для угадывания этого числа нам нужно выбрать из диапазона от 1 до N, используя наши знания.

Мы также знаем, что 10 битов информации снова означают, что у нас есть 10 выборов, каждый из которых может быть единицей или нулем.

Теперь наша задача состоит в том, чтобы найти значение N. Мы можем использовать такую же логику, применив умножение на каждом шаге: 2 * 2 * 2 * ... * 2 = 2^10. Это общее количество возможных событий, которое соответствует 10 битам информации при угадывании числа в диапазоне от 1 до N. Таким образом, мы получаем, что 2^10 = N.

Итак, мы находим, что N равно 1024.

Надеюсь, что ясно объяснил, как используется количество информации для определения количества возможных событий в каждой из задач.+
4,7(94 оценок)
Это интересно:
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